about this team
The Lease Management team is responsible for the portfolio management of lease terms and requirements, ensuring adherence to the lease across the North American retail store portfolio. This role ensures that all lease terms align with executive approvals, meet financial targets, and adhere to global deal standards. Key responsibilities include lease reviews, oversight of lease data, critical date management, and the development of reporting and analytics related to lease actions. The Lease Management team collaborates closely with internal and external stakeholders—including Lease Administration, Real Estate, Construction, Finance, Store Operations, Legal teams, and Landlords, ensuring seamless execution and compliance of lease documents.
